Båsmyråsen
Båsmyråsen is a hill in Melhus, Trøndelag and has an elevation of 253 metres. Båsmyråsen is situated nearby to the hamlet Solemen, as well as near Valdøyan.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Horg Church
Church
Photo: Jensens, Public domain.
Horg Church is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Melhus Municipality in Trøndelag county, Norway. It is located just south of the village of Lundamo, on the east side of the European route E06 highway and the river Gaula. Horg Church is situated 4 km south of Båsmyråsen.
